Real Name: Kakarot Race: Saiyan Height: 175cm Weight: 62kg Age: 23 Birth Year: Age 737 Hobbies: Finding strong opponents and fighting Favorite Food: No dislikes Favorite Vehicle: Flying Nimbus (Kintoun) Dislikes: Coffee, injections (hates them). Regarding beer, he isn't unable to drink it; in the original manga and 'Super', he is depicted drinking it happily. Appearance: Straight black hair, black eyes, and a skin tone that is neither dark nor pale—a look that would be considered Asian in the real world (a trait shared by all pure-blooded Saiyans). He has a unique, asymmetrical spiky hairstyle. He doesn't use styling products; it's simply the natural way his hair grows. Later, it is established that a pure Saiyan's hair does not grow past a certain point, resulting in a permanent, specific hairstyle for each individual (Vegeta notes that their hair doesn't "creepily keep growing or changing styles like Earthlings"). Facial Features: In his young adulthood, Bulma describes him as having become "handsome and impressive." Clothing: He primarily wears his martial arts gi and rarely wears civilian clothes unless absolutely necessary. First person: I (Ora - casual, rustic). Second person: You (Omee - blunt/dialect) or by name without honorifics. His unique dialect is likely inherited from his adoptive grandfather, Gohan, who spoke in a rough, plain-spoken manner. Speech Pattern: He often shifts "-ai" sounds to "-ee" (e.g., "tatakaitai" becomes "tatakeetee"). However, he pronounces proper names like King Kai (Kaio) normally. When transformed into a Super Saiyan, his first person changes to "I" (Ore - rough, masculine), and his dialect disappears, replaced by a more aggressive tone. Personality: While he has lost the typical Saiyan savagery, he remains a Saiyan at heart. Combined with Grandpa Gohan's teachings, he is extremely battle-hungry and gets excited when meeting strong opponents. However, Goku is the type who values self-improvement over the desire to simply defeat others. He possesses two sides: a "kind-hearted martial artist" and a "battle-hungry warrior." While he actively challenges the strong, he rarely gets depressed even if he loses. Instead, his eyes light up with the desire to train and fight again. This trait is apparently rare among Saiyans. (Surprisingly, in the original work, there are few instances where he recklessly picks fights just because someone is strong.) Knowledge: From the start of the story until adulthood, he is extremely ignorant regarding sexual matters. Intelligence: In combat, he doesn't just rely on brute force; he uses feints and terrain effectively. During the Majin Buu arc, he calmly analyzes the best course of action, including the use of the Dragon Balls. He isn't stupid; rather, he is simply worldly-ignorant and lacks formal knowledge, while his intuition in crises far exceeds that of an average person. Etiquette: While he intends to show respect to superiors (always using titles like "Karin-sama," "Kaio-sama," or "Kaioshin-sama"), he struggles to maintain a formal attitude. When he first visited King Kai's planet, he started with bows and polite speech but quickly reverted to his natural, casual way of talking. However, he has always called his master Master Roshi "Kamesennin no Jicchan" (Gramps Roshi). He seems to have a special attachment to him, and even after far surpassing Roshi's power, he never changes how he treats his master. He dislikes killing even great villains if they are incapacitated. He often advises defeated opponents to leave rather than delivering a finishing blow. He avoids pointless fights and won't engage in battles where the outcome is already obvious. Appetite: He is an extraordinary glutton with an incredibly strong digestive system, easily clearing tables piled high with food. His cheerful way of eating is arguably one of the highlights of the series. Dexterity: He can use chopsticks, knives, forks, and spoons with either hand, suggesting he is ambidextrous, though he uses his right hand for the Power Pole (Nyoibo) and writing utensils. Durability: His body is tougher than stainless steel and can deflect bullets, but he is notably weak against the cold.
